Purrloin, the Devious Pokémon, is a Dark-type Pokémon introduced in Generation V, hailing from the Unova region. It evolves into Liepard starting at level 20. Known for its cunning and playful nature, Purrloin often uses its charming appearance to trick unsuspecting individuals into giving it food or other valuables. Its sleek, feline design and mischievous grin perfectly embody its Pokédex entries, which frequently describe its penchant for petty thievery. In the Pokémon world, Purrloin typically roams urban areas and forests, often found lurking in shadows, waiting for an opportunity to swipe something shiny. As a Dark-type, it is strong against Psychic and Ghost types but vulnerable to Fighting, Bug, and Fairy moves. In the anime, Purrloin has been featured in various episodes, often showcasing its deceptive abilities and sometimes causing trouble for the main characters. Its presence in the games adds a touch of slyness and urban charm to the Pokémon ecosystem, making it a memorable early-game encounter for many trainers.
